Feb 12, 2020 All Whirlpool Duet dryers have sensor strips in the drum. As your load of laundry tumbles in the drum, it makes contact with the sensor strips so that the dryer can end the cycle when your laundry is dry. If the dryer is not level, the sensing does not work properly, and your drying cycle will end early.

A load that is too large for the dryer will not tumble and limits air movement in the dryer. This slows the process of removing moist air out of the dryer, which will result in longer drying cycles. Sep 06, 2013 Sometimes, clothes will stop drying properly on the Auto Dry cycle but still dry normally on the Timed Dry cycle. Brother john63, the Dean of LG Appliantology, has developed a simple procedure to correct this problem and it works on all brands and models of dryers with an Auto Dry …
If your gas or electric dryer isn’t ending the Auto Dry cycle when the clothes are dry, it may be the fault of a defective cycling thermostat. This part governs the temperature of the dryer as well as the timer motor on Auto Dry models. A defective thermostat may not allow the timer to advance to the off position and continue to run.

Sep 22, 2019 It's a common complaint about heat pump dryers that sometimes clothes 'don't get fully dry'. They do, but it can take a bit of getting used to. After the cycle finishes, you open the door and grab the clothes and you straight away think geez, they're still wet. But they're not- it's just the way the dryer works. Blankets and doonas aren't an issue.
